Compagnie de Saint-Gobain Short Interest Overview

As of November 14, 2025, Compagnie de Saint-Gobain (CODYY) had a short interest of 95,374 shares sold short, representing 0.00% of the public float. This marks a 101.80% increase in short interest since the prior report. The short interest ratio (days to cover) is 0.2, meaning it would take 0.2 days of the average trading volume of 658,819 shares to cover all short positions.

What does it mean to sell short Compagnie de Saint-Gobain stock?

Short selling CODYY is an investing strategy that aims to generate trading profit from Compagnie de Saint-Gobain as its price is falling. CODYY shares are trading up $0.30 today. To short a stock, an investor borrows shares, sells them and buys the shares back on the public market later to return it to the lender. Short sellers are betting that a stock will decline in price. If the stock does drop after selling, the short seller buys it back at a lower price and returns it to the lender. The difference between the sell price and the buy price is the trader's profit.

How does a short squeeze work against Compagnie de Saint-Gobain?

A short squeeze for Compagnie de Saint-Gobain occurs when it has a large amount of short interest and its stock increases in price. This forces short sellers to cover their short interest positions by buying actual shares of CODYY, which in turn drives the price of the stock up even further.

What do CODYY's short interest metrics mean?

Understanding short interest metrics can help you assess how traders are positioning around a stock like CODYY:

  • Shares Sold Short: The total number of shares that have been sold by short sellers but have not yet been covered or closed out. A high number may indicate bearish sentiment.
  • Short Float: The percentage of a company’s publicly available shares (or "float") that are sold short. A higher short float suggests a greater portion of the stock is being bet against.
  • Days to Cover (Short Interest Ratio): This estimates how many days it would take short sellers to cover their positions, based on average daily trading volume. Higher values can signal potential for a short squeeze if buying pressure increases.

These metrics are often used by traders to gauge sentiment, volatility risk, and the potential for price movements based on short covering activity.
